Curbside Yard Waste Collection Guidelines
- No trash or treated wood to be mixed in with yard waste please.
- Do not tie or bundle any branches. Simply stack them neatly in front of your house, as far away from your garbage can as possible.
- Smaller items such as grass and shrub clippings should be put into a yard bag, or you may place smaller yard debris into a garbage can, and leave the top off so the truck driver can identify it as yard waste. Cans used cannot be any larger than 35 gallons.
- Please place regular garbage and your yard waste as far apart as possible on the curb.
- Limbs can be no larger than 18 inches in diameter, 50 lbs and 6 feet in length. No root balls allowed.
- Place your yard waste on the curb the night before your regular garbage collection day.
